Nghe An Newspaper and readers continue to support people in flooded areas of Quy Chau
(Baonghean.vn) - On the morning of October 5, Nghe An Newspaper and readers continued to support the flood victims in Quy Chau district with necessities and school supplies to help people quickly overcome natural disasters and stabilize their lives. This is the second relief trip of Nghe An Newspaper for the people here.
Accompanying Nghe An Newspaper on this relief trip, Nghe An Agricultural Materials Joint Stock Corporation supported 1 truck of Thien Nhan mineral water including 175 20-liter water barrels (worth 16.8 million VND). In addition, the Company also supported a truck carrying 2 tons of rice and essential goods to Quy Chau.
Officers and employees of Vinh Urban Environment and Construction Company also donated 1 ton of rice (worth 17 million VND) to support people in the flooded area of Quy Chau - this is also one of the meaningful activities of the Company before the 50th anniversary of the unit's establishment.

During this relief trip, Nghe An Newspaper presented necessities and essential goods to two villages in Chau Binh commune, Chau Thang Primary School and Quy Chau High School.
In Khe Khoang and Khe Can villages (Chau Binh commune), Nghe An Newspaper presented 500 kg of rice, 50 barrels of water and 11 cash gifts (each worth 500,000 VND); presented 1 ton of rice and 40 barrels of water to boarding students of Quy Chau High School affected by floods and 10 million VND to support teachers who participated in overcoming the consequences of natural disasters; presented 1,460 student notebooks and 35 barrels of water to Chau Thang Primary School.
The total value of goods and necessities to support people in the flooded area of Quy Chau in both phases is estimated at over 166 million VND (of which officials, reporters, employees and children of Nghe An Newspaper donated over 40 million VND, the rest came from readers, organizations and benefactors).


Moved by the help from Nghe An Newspaper and readers, Ms. Lim Thi Tuyet in Khe Khoang village, Chau Binh commune (Quy Chau) said that the recent flood had washed away all the property and food in the house. Thanks to the care of Nghe An Newspaper and other benefactors, her family now has more rice and drinking water to continue for many days to come. The rice in the fields was flooded and damaged; replanting will have to wait until next year.

Ms. Tran Thi Hang - Principal of Chau Thang Primary School said that after many days of efforts by the teaching staff and local authorities to overcome the consequences of the flood, on October 4, the school's students returned to school. The flood caused flooding in classrooms, causing severe damage to school equipment and supplies, with estimated damage of over 4 billion VND. The school received support from Nghe An Newspaper with 1,460 student notebooks and drinking water. This is a meaningful gift to help the school and students overcome difficulties to study with peace of mind; at the same time, she hopes that Nghe An Newspaper and benefactors will continue to join hands and help so that the school can purchase equipment and teaching and learning aids.


Previously, on October 1, after learning about the damage caused by floods to people in the western districts of Nghe An (in which Quy Chau district was the most severely affected), Nghe An Newspaper and readers directly went to the places to deliver 3 tons of rice and other essential goods to the communes of Chau Hanh, Chau Thang, Chau Tien, Quy Chau district. These are the 3 communes that suffered heavy damage due to the flood on the night of September 27. In addition, Nghe An Newspaper and benefactors also gave 30 gifts, each worth 500,000 VND, to 30 households that suffered heavy damage due to floods in these 3 communes, along with 4 boxes of books and notebooks for students in Chau Thang commune; supported 5 million VND for the family of reporter Be Vinh - working at the Center for Culture, Information and Sports of Quy Chau district, which also suffered serious damage due to floods.
